    Dorothy B's Holiday Green Beans

    List of Ingredients




    2 cups water
    1 teaspoon salt
    27 ounces green beans -- frozen french cut
    12 slices bacon -- cooked until crisp and crumbled
    1 teaspoon seasoned salt
    1 1/2 cups sour cream
    6 ounces French Fried Onions

    Recipe



    Bring water to a boil and toss in the salt. Add beans and cook until
    tender crisp. Drain and place in a 1 1/2-quart casserole. Mix bacon,
    seasoned salt, and half of the onion rings, and combine with the
    beans. Spread sour cream over the top of the casserole, and sprinkle
    with the remaining onions.

    Bake about 10-15 minutes at 350F or until heated through. (I think
    this assumes you are proceeding while the beans are still fairly warm
    at least.)

    Per Serving (excluding unknown items): 247 Calories; 19g Fat (70.6%
    calories from fat); 5g Protein; 14g Carbohydrate; 2g Dietary Fiber;
    22mg Cholesterol; 639mg Sodium. Exchanges: 1/2 Lean Meat; 1
    Vegetable; 0 Non-Fat Milk; 2 Fat; 0 Other Carbohydrates.
